Output db2661eaa79f3faef2c16400d8baf8d18a07e9a5e225fe30a6730e39d76d8464:28

value
169072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 632d852c6da34e835f2cf72ae43a30ebbc98d0d5 OP_EQUAL
address
3AjRMLMfdqSF32u2zFSNTtrpF26q4R6sY3
transaction
db2661eaa79f3faef2c16400d8baf8d18a07e9a5e225fe30a6730e39d76d8464
spent
true